Catharine was the youngest child of Thomas A. & Catharine Bartholomew McNaught. She married Samuel Campbell Wilson in Owen Co, IN on Aug 1, 1852. Samuel was the son of James and Mary Campbell Wilson.

Samuel & Catharine had 4 children:

1. SARAH ISABELLE 1856-1946 married Samuel Cavins Sadler

2. MARY ca 1858-1870

3. WILLIAM ca 1858-1870

4. ODUS LINCOLN 1865-1935 married Ella Marshall

Mary & William are found in the 1860 Owen Co, IN census, ages 2 years old, but do not appear in the 1870 census.

In the 1900 Shawnee, KS census, Catharine is reported to have been the mother of two children with two still living. I can not account for the discrepancy. She was living with her daughter, Sarah, at the time, both are reported to be widowed. Catharine certainly was, I am not so sure about Sarah, whose occupation is physician.

In Catharine's obituary found in the Owen Co (IN) Democrat dated Jan 13, 1921, she was raised in the Methodist church, but in later years, "she shared much of her husband's & daughter's belief in the teachings of the Seventh Day Adventists".

The funeral was at her son's residence, with burial at the McNaught cemetery on River Hill. She was survived by her brother, Capt Robert McNaught of Owen Co; son, Odus of Owen Co; daughter, Sarah of Seattle; grandchildren Marie Sadler of Seattle WA, Pavil Wilson of Bloomington IN, Dr William S Sadler Sr & great grandson, William S Sadler Jr of Chicago IL.

"CATHERINE WILSON is also recorded in the DAR Cemetery Index as being buried at River Hill and the DAR Cemetery Index was composed by DAR members walking the cemeteries and recording the stones."

This information was provided to me in an email from Laura Wilkerson of the Owen Co (IN) Library in Spencer, IN on Aug 15, 2013.

~~~~~~~~~~~~~
No headstone or memorial was located for her in 2013.
